RRDtool (acronym for round-robin database tool) aims to handle time-series data like network bandwidth, temperatures, CPU load, etc. The data are stored in a round-robin database (circular buffer), thus the system storage footprint remains constant over time.

RubyMotion is an implementation of the Ruby programming language that runs on Android, iOS and OS X. RubyMotion is a commercial product created by Laurent Sansonetti for HipByte and is based on MacRuby for OS X.
